Q: Is 22,961,260 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,961,260 is a composite number.

Why is 22,961,260 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,961,260 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 7 10 14 20 28 35 70 140 401 409 802 818 1,604 1,636 2,005 2,045 2,807 2,863 4,010 4,090 5,614 5,726 8,020 8,180 11,228 11,452 14,035 14,315 28,070 28,630 56,140 57,260 164,009 328,018 656,036 820,045 1,148,063 1,640,090 2,296,126 3,280,180 4,592,252 5,740,315 11,480,630 and 22,961,260, with no remainder.

Since 22,961,260 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,961,260, it is a composite number.
